Latest Patents

Wickert holds a patent for a high solids water-borne surface coating containing hollow particulates. This innovative coating comprises a latex polymer, non-film-forming particulates, and water. The formulation allows for up to 90% solids, with a pigment volume concentration (PVC) ranging from about 5% to 95%. The coating dries quickly and exhibits excellent through-dry properties, including tensile strength, elongation, and water resistance. It is designed to replace traditional coatings used in multi-coat processes and can contain up to 40% hollow microspheres, yielding a dried coating with a PVC of up to 57%. This coating meets the required elongation of at least 200%, making it suitable for use as a roof coating.

Career Highlights

Wickert is associated with Tremco Incorporated, a company known for its innovative building materials and solutions. His work at Tremco has allowed him to focus on developing advanced coatings that meet modern construction needs.
